Output eee860bdb3ef52b5817e2960dc7e1ae29ba88f417968f8cbdb6a05adf839461a:27

value
10727133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f31d11100c50154c08c977bc07acd5fb6b8b51 OP_EQUAL
address
32WLZuMJ8voeBnVVimteuuyAaBV4EfUGhd
transaction
eee860bdb3ef52b5817e2960dc7e1ae29ba88f417968f8cbdb6a05adf839461a
spent
true